The Google search engine was developed in September 1998 by two Stanford University Ph.D. candidates named Larry Page and Sergey Brin. Google was initially developed as a research project with the goal of employing an algorithm to locate relevant search results.

By examining relationships between individual webpages based on their cross-references, the algorithm—later known as PageRank—assessed the value of each one. The phrase googol, which denotes an extremely high number of 1 followed by 100 zeros (10100), is intentionally misspelled in the name Google.

Want to take a ride to the past? It is, in fact, possible with Google. More specifically. It is possible with the help of Google 1998.

Google developed this one to commemorate its 15th birthday. You can see what Google genuinely looked like in the beginning thanks to this particular Easter Egg. One of those elegant search engine result pages will appear if you type in “Google in 1998” or “Google 1998,” and it will look just like the webpage from December 1998.

Google chose to provide a fun Easter egg depicting the site’s original design from 1998 to commemorate its 15th birthday. Simply enter “google in 1998” (without the quotations) into your search engine to see it for yourself. Unfortunately, using the 1998 Google Easter egg search engine won’t let you conduct a real search.

The Google.com website will change into the layout it had when the company was initially established if you type “Google in 1998” into the search bar. Don’t be alarmed if the old style and exclamation point remind you of Yahoo. Just below the search box, there is a large blue link that says, “take me back to present.” You can return to the current Google by clicking that.

Take note of the invitation Google sent users at the bottom to try their searches on other popular search engines of the time, including AltaVista, HotBot, Excite, Infoseek, and Lycos. You can access an archived version of the traditional search engines by clicking on those links.

It is fascinating to see how far the search engine has come from the 10 blue links to more dynamic search engines, enabling universal search items like images, video, and news, even though you can’t perform a search in the outdated version of Google.

There are several popular Easter eggs that you can try to have fun with when it comes to Google. Over the years, Google has provided a tonne of Easter eggs to keep nerds like myself amused.

Some of these involved asking the search engine queries like “the answer to the most important question in life, the universe, and everything,” to which it responds “42,” or “define anagram,” to which it says “did you mean: nerd fame again.”

Other things you could do included asking Google to “do a barrel roll,” to which it would respond by rotating your screen continuously rather than by providing an answer. And this is not all! You can also play the famous PACMAN on Google simply by typing it in the search bar!

Here are some of the most popular Google Easter eggs that you need to know about in 2023:

1. Do A Barrel Roll  

This search term will cause the Easter Egg to startle you by performing a 360-degree flip. The funniest thing is that the results may even be displayed upside-down.

2. Google Gravity  

You will be amazed to witness how the entire result page on your screen just shatters into pieces as soon as you search for this Easter egg, leaving you with nothing but a blank screen. To make sure that they all return to their positions, you must drag each and every piece upward.

3. BLINK  

the flash One of Google’s most fun Easter eggs for consumers is HTML, despite the fact that it irritates some people. What occurs when Blink HTML is entered into the search box? On your SERP, certain words begin to blink.

4. Snake  

Remember the classic favorites you used to play endlessly as a kid, like Memory Game and Snake? Type “snake” or similar terms, such as “snake game,” and they will all display the game’s outcomes.

Dedicated server hosting has been there for a long time and has become a preferred choice for large enterprises because of the control they get out of it. In fact, the security of data achieved in a dedicated environment is much more than shared or VPS hosting. However, dedicated hosting is very costly in nature. This is the reason why server colocation hosting in India has become so popular. It also gives you full control of your hardware and software resources of the server. But it can be availed at a far lesser price. This is possible because you are only buying rack space to put your server machinery. In another popular colocation arrangement solution, businesses rent server and rack space from a data center that provides server colocation services. One of the important features of server colocation hosting in India is that you as a business entity retain complete ownership of the IT hardware, thereby having full control of the same. In a sense, it provides you dedicated control of server resources. It is preferable to dedicated hosting because colocation is available at least possible price. Also read: What Makes a Web Hosting Good? However, in case of a dedicated hosting solution, the data center from which you are getting the service is the sole owner of the hardware system and other IT resources. Though the client gets full control of the server, the infrastructure, build, and content, ownership rights remain with the data center. Though you have dedicated control, you don’t really have ownership rights. When to choose Dedicated Hosting and when Colocation Server? If there is a huge traffic inflow into your site or group of websites and there are some mission-critical missions that require dedicated hosting environment, dedicated hosting is preferred. This is because of the high level of security provided to the stored data. However, to avail this service you have to shell out a lot of money, which may not be always possible. In the case of server colocation hosting in India, you get increased security, enhanced scalability, enhanced connectivity, and extremely high availability. This is especially suitable for companies or businesses that don’t have the means of creating in-house hosting solutions (which are outrightly costly). Let’s dig more into Colocation Services In this kind of hosting solution, both software and hardware are purchased and owned by the business entity itself. In fact, the onus of properly setting up and configuring the hardware IT of the server rests with the business itself. For effectively managing inflow and outflow of traffic, the business entity can also buy one or more network devices such as VPN appliance, firewall, router, switch, and others. The combination of network devices a business wants to choose rests with that business itself. The server colocation hosting in India has no role in deciding on these factors. Therefore, the control and flexibility one gets in colocation are even much more than in the case of dedicated servers. Moreover, colocation comes at a far lesser price.
